Room-temperature photoluminescence in amorphous SrTiO3-The influence of acceptor-type dopants
(2002-11-01)
Room-temperature photoluminescence (PL) was observed in undoped and 2 mol% Cr-, Al- and Y-doped amorphous SrTiO3 thin films. Doping increased the PL, and in the case of Cr significantly reduced the associated PL wavelength. ...
